What is a Bedside Cot?
A Bedside Crib For Babies cot is a special crib created to be placed beside an adult bed. It typically includes an adjustable side that can be decreased, allowing easy access to the baby without the requirement to get out of bed. This design supports a safe sleeping plan while making nighttime feedings more manageable.

Key Features of Bedside Cots
1. Adjustable Height Settings:
Many bedside cots include adjustable height settings, allowing them to fit comfortably against various bed heights for easy access.
2. Drop-Side Mechanism:
This feature allows parents to lower the Side Sleeping Crib of the cot, making it even much easier to reach the baby without the requirement for excessive motion.
3. Compact Size:
Designed to use up minimal space, bedside cots can fit along with almost any bed configuration, even in smaller sized spaces.
4. Portability:
Some models are light-weight and can be easily moved from room to room, enhancing their functionality throughout early parenting.
5. Safety Standards:

Getting the most from a bedside cot involves comprehending its features and how best to use them. Here are pointers for effective nighttime feeding with a bedside cot:
Align the Cot with Your Bed: Position the cot so it fits safely versus the adult bed. This improves ease of access and ease of interaction with the baby.
Keep Feeding Essentials Nearby: Store baby bottles, burp cloths, and diapers within reach, so you are completely geared up when it's feeding time.
Practice Gentle Nighttime Routines: Help your baby associate nighttime with peace by maintaining a quiet and soothing environment during feedings.
Use Natural Light: If possible, use dim lighting during late-night feedings to prevent totally waking yourself or the baby.
Avoid Lifting the Baby Too Much: Rather than lifting the baby out of the cot for each feeding, learn to feed conveniently in the cot as required.
